Before you begin assembling your ingredients, it’s essential to pre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Preheating ensures that the bake cooks evenly and thoroughly. While the oven is heating, prepare your baking dish by greasing it with a little olive oil or cooking spray. This step is crucial to prevent the bake from sticking and to allow for easy serving once it’s cooked.
An adequately greased baking dish will promote even cooking and browning, leading to a perfectly baked dish. If you skip this step, you risk having parts of the bake stick to the dish, making it a hassle to serve. Ensure you cover the entire bottom and sides of the dish for the best results.
In a large mixing bowl, crack the eggs and whisk them together until they are well combined. This step is essential for achieving a smooth and cohesive mixture. To the beaten eggs, add the cottage cheese, cheddar cheese, sautéed spinach, bell peppers, and onions.
To ensure a smooth consistency, use a fork or a whisk to incorporate all the ingredients thoroughly. This will help break up any lumps of cottage cheese and evenly distribute the flavors throughout the mixture. Season with salt, pepper, and any additional herbs you desire, mixing well to combine. It’s important to taste the mixture at this point to adjust the seasoning to your preference before transferring it to the baking dish.
Once everything is combined, pour the egg and cheese mixture into the prepared baking dish. Spread it evenly with a spatula to ensure even cooking.
Now you’re ready to bake your Cheesy Cottage Delight Bake. Place it in the preheated oven and allow it to cook for about 30-35 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and a knife inserted into the center comes out clean. Now that your Cheesy Cottage Delight Bake is assembled, it’s time to put it in the oven.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and place the dish in the center.
You’ll know your bake is done when the top is golden brown and bubbly. The cheese should be melted and slightly caramelized, creating that perfect contrast between creamy and crispy textures. Additionally, a toothpick inserted in the center should come out clean, indicating that the eggs have set properly.
Once baked, let your Cheesy Cottage Delight Bake cool for about 10-15 minutes before serving. This resting period allows the dish to firm up slightly, making it easier to cut and serve.
For garnishing, consider sprinkling fresh herbs, such as parsley or chives, on top just before serving. This adds a pop of color and a fresh burst of flavor.

If you find yourself with leftovers (which is rare because it’s so delicious!), here’s how to store and reheat your Cheesy Cottage Delight Bake effectively:
– Best Practices for Storing Leftovers: Allow the bake to cool completely before transferring it to an airtight container. You can store it in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. If you want to keep it longer, consider freezing it.
– Reheating Without Compromising Texture and Flavor: To reheat,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Place the bake in an oven-safe dish, cover with foil to prevent drying out, and heat for about 20 minutes or until warmed through. Alternatively, you can microwave individual portions for a quick reheating option.
– Discussion on Freezing Options: If you decide to freeze your Cheesy Cottage Delight Bake, make sure to w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and then aluminum foil to prevent freezer burn. It can be stored in the freezer for up to 2 months. To thaw, simply place it in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.
